David Portnoy on the Stock Market, Trump’s Economic Policies, and the Future of Online Gambling Stocks
Barstool Sports founder David Portnoy has shared his views during a volatile time for the stock market, expressing optimism that President Trump’s recent announcements aimed at stabilizing equity markets will provide a significant boost to online gambling stocks. As political shifts influence investor sentiment, Portnoys outlook suggests a potential turning point for the gaming sector and its associated equities.

In a discussion with CNN, Portnoy articulated his hope for a market rebound, contingent on clarity from Trump concerning the ongoing tariff situation, which has caused great uncertainty among investors.
Market Reactions to Political Decisions
Just hours after Portnoy’s remarks, Trump announced a 90-day pause on trade tariffs impacting various US trading partners, a move that analysts interpreted as potentially positive for the stock market. The news led to a surge in the S&P 500 by 9.52%, showcasing the market’s volatility influenced by political discourse.
Portnoy’s Financial Ups and Downs
Despite experiencing significant losses, with estimates suggesting he lost as much as $20 million, Portnoy maintains his support for Trump, valuing his forthright communication style.
- Portnoy claims to have been heavily impacted by the drop in stock values, including a substantial stake in Penn Entertainment.
- He remains hopeful about a market recovery, reflecting confidence in Trump’s ability to navigate economic challenges.
Portnoy’s Stock Portfolio Insights
In addition to his major investments in Penn Entertainment, Portnoy has been open about other stock holdings, including shares in DraftKings and Wynn Resorts, both of which saw notable increases following Trump’s economic announcements.
